The ingredients needed to cook Slow Cooker Pork Tenderloin:
- Prepare Pork tenderloin
- Get Garlic
- Use salt and pepper
- Provide Olive oil
- Take Carrots and potatoes
- Get Onion
- You need Chicken broth
- You need Soy sauce
- Use Balsamic vinegar
Steps to make Slow Cooker Pork Tenderloin:
- Sauté several cloves of garlic and brown the pork (sprinkled with salt and pepper) in a cast-iron skillet. Careful not to burn the garlic! I admit it was hard.
- Use butter, olive oil, or whatever you like to grease the slow cooker and add sliced onion to the bottom. Add potatoes and carrots.
- Once the pork is browned, add it to the slow cooker. I went ahead and scraped in the cooking bits, oil, and garlic as well.
- Pour in about 8 ounces of chicken broth. A splash of soy sauce and balsamic vinegar is good too.
- Set the slow cooker to low for 6-8 hours. Take the meat out to let it rest for 10 minutes, then slice. Pour the vegetables and cooking liquid over the meat.
